🥘 Ingredients

12 items
  • 1 cup (chopped) fresh okra
  • 1.5 cups all-purpose flour
  • 0.5 cups cornmeal
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oons baking soda
  • 0.5 teaspoons salt
  • 1 tablespoon sugar
  • 1 cup buttermilk
  • 2 pieces large eggs
  • 0.25 cups unsalted butter (melted)
  • 0.75 cups cheddar cheese (shredded)
  • 0.25 cups green onions (finely chopped)

📝 Instructions

10 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and grease a standard 12-cup muffin tin or line it with paper liners.

2

Wash the okra thoroughly, remove the stems, and chop it into small pieces measuring about 1/4 inch thick. Set aside.

3

In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, cornmeal,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and sugar.

4

In a separate bowl, combine the buttermilk, eggs, and melted butter. Whisk until well incorporated.

5

Create a well in the center of the dry ingredients and pour in the wet mixture. Stir gently until just combined; do not overmix.

6

Fold in the chopped fresh okra, shredded cheddar cheese, and green onions until evenly distributed throughout the batter.

7

Using a spoon or ice cream scoop, divide the batter evenly into the prepared muffin tin, filling each cup about two-thirds full.

8

Bake for 18-20 minutes, or until the tops are golden brown and a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.

9

Remove the muffin tin from the oven and allow the muffins to cool in the tin for 5 minutes, then transfer them to a wire rack to cool completely.

10

Serve warm or at room temperature. These muffins pair beautifully with soups, stews, or even a pat of butter for a quick snack.

Nutrition Facts

1 serving (81.5g)
Calories
186
% Daily Value*
Total Fat 8.2 g 11%
Saturated Fat 4.8 g 24%
Polyunsaturated Fat 0.1 g
Cholesterol 52 mg 17%
Sodium 348 mg 15%
Total Carbohydrate 22.1 g 8%
Dietary Fiber 1.5 g 5%
Total Sugars 2.5 g
Protein 6.0 g 12%
Vitamin D 0.6 mcg 3%
Calcium 93 mg 7%
Iron 1.1 mg 6%
Potassium 119 mg 3%
